Section II.        Composition and Information on Ingredients    
    Chemical Name        CAS Number Percent (%)        TLV/PEL        Toxicology Data    
    3a,4,7,7a-Tetrahydroindene        3048-65-5        Min. 98.0 Not available.        Rat LD50 (oral) 3730 mg/kg    
    Rabbit LD50 (dermal) 14,100 mg/kg
    (GC)
    Mouse LD50 (oral) 3500 mg/kg

Section IV.        First Aid Measures    
    Eye Contact        Check for and remove any contact lenses. DO NOT use an eye ointment. Flush eyes with running water for a minimum    
    of 15 minutes, occasionally lifting the upper and lower eyelids. Seek medical attention. Treat symptomatically and
    supportively.
    Skin Contact        If the chemical gets spilled on a clothed portion of the body, remove the contaminated clothes as quickly as possible,    
    protecting your own hands and body. Place the victim under a deluge shower. If the chemical touches the victim's
    exposed skin, such as the hands: Gently and thoroughly wash the contaminated skin with running water and non-abrasive
    soap. Be particularly careful to clean folds, crevices, creases and groin. Cover the irritated skin with an emollient. Seek
    medical attention. Treat symptomatically and supportively. Wash any contaminated clothing before reusing.
    Inhalation        If the victim is not breathing, perform artificial respiration. Loosen tight clothing such as a collar, tie, belt or waistband. If    
    breathing is difficult, oxygen can be administered. Seek medical attention. Treat symptomatically and supportively.
    Ingestion        INDUCE VOMITING by sticking finger in throat. Lower the head so that the vomit will not reenter the mouth and throat.    
    Loosen tight clothing such as a collar, tie, belt, or waistband. If the victim is not breathing, administer artificial respiration.
    Examine the lips and mouth to ascertain whether the tissues are damaged, a possible indication that the toxic material
    was ingested; the absence of such signs, however, is not conclusive. Seek immediate medical attention and, if possible,
    show the chemical label. Treat symptomatically and supportively.

Section VII. Handling and Storage
    FLAMMABLE. Reactive with strong oxidizers; may be ignited by heat, sparks, or flames. Vapors may travel to source of
    Handling and Storage
    ignition and flash back. Tightly seal container and store in a cool place. Closed containers may explode from heat of a
    Information
    fire. Empty containers may pose a fire risk. Evaporate residue under a fume hood if possible. Ground all equipment
    containing material. Keep away from heat and sources of ignition. Mechanical exhaust required. Avoid excessive heat
    and light. Do not breathe gas, fumes, vapor or spray. In case of insufficient ventilation, wear suitable respiratory
    equipment. If you feel unwell, seek medical attention and show the label when possible. Treat symptomatically and
    supportively. Avoid contact with skin and eyes.
    Always store away from incompatible compounds such as oxidizing agents.

Section XI. Toxicological Information
    RTECS Number        NK8750000    
    Routes of Exposure        Eye contact. Inhalation. Ingestion.    
    Toxicity Data        Rat LD50 (oral) 3730 mg/kg    
    Rabbit LD50 (dermal) 14,100 mg/kg
    Mouse LD50 (oral) 3500 mg/kg
